Law360, New York ( December 23, 2014, 10:31 AM EST) -- Infringement and invalidity contentions are patent litigation trial cornerstones. Appreciating this, the Northern District of California requires parties to serve these contentions early in the case. Patent Local Rule 3-1 requires infringement contentions be served no later than 14 days after the initial case management conference.[1] Patent Local Rule 3-3 requires invalidity contentions be served no later than 45 days after service of the infringement contentions.[2]...
